Admission Snapshot
Typical admitted student: Applicants must hold a bachelor's degree in electrical engineering, computer science, mathematics, or a related technical field with a minimum GPA of 3.0. A background in linear algebra, calculus, programming, and probability is typically required or expected.

What You'll Learn
- Design and implement signal processing pipelines for multi-dimensional data including images and video streams
- Develop and train machine learning models, particularly deep neural networks, for computer vision tasks such as classification, detection, and segmentation
- Apply optimization algorithms to solve large-scale machine learning problems efficiently
- Evaluate and validate computer vision systems using statistical methods and performance metrics
Curriculum Highlights
The structure consists of required focus area courses, subarea-specific electives, and foundational mathematics covering statistical methods for detection and estimation.
